BP1870 reports that "The Lefevres came from the neighbourhood of Rouen, in Normandy, and established themselves in England at the Revocation of the Edict of Nantes." The "two members of the family who first came to England" were John (Lt. Colonel), who settled in Essex, and his younger brother ...

The following family is presumed to have been one of those who derived their name from Lockwood in Yorkshire. Their coat of arms is very different from that of the family which derived its name from Lockwood in Staffordshire (see Lockwood1).
